On Morning Joe, discussing the way American kids are falling behind children in other countries on academic achievement scores, and describing how they are coddled, giving trophies for non-existent achievement and protected from stress, New York Times columnist Thomas Friedman says: "stress will be not understanding the thick Chinese accent of your first boss. That will be stress."
